
Magnetite is a typical corrosion product in closed heating, cooling and process water circuits. Fine magnetite particles can significantly affect pumps, valves, heat exchangers and control valves. Magnetite separation is based on the targeted removal of magnetic particles from the water cycle. ORBEN uses powerful magnetic separation systems for this purpose, which reliably capture even the finest particles. These systems are designed to operate continuously and do not require any interruption of plant operation.
A key advantage of ORB magnetite separation is its precise integration into existing systems. Separators can be installed in both main and side flows, depending on system geometry, flow rate and degree of contamination. As a result, optimum separation efficiency is achieved with minimal pressure loss.
The removal of magnetite not only reduces mechanical wear, but also improves the heat transfer and control accuracy of the system. At the same time, maintenance costs are significantly reduced as deposits in sensitive components are avoided. This has a direct positive effect on energy efficiency and operating costs.
